I called on 1/20/2011 to cancel my services with Castle Rock Security. I have more than fulfilled my 3 year contract agreement, I have had this alarm for 5 years. They don't even call when the alarm goes off-line.

Castle Rock Security stated that I cannot cancel my services until May, 2011 because my original contract states I have a "roll over" of a year if services are not canceled in writing 30 days prior to the "roll over" date. Castle Rock Security is one of the only businesses to still have such a contract. I think, don't know for sure, but if they are the ONLY one's who have such a contract that creates a problem in itself. But, if I signed a contract that said I agreed to a yearly "roll over" then I have no legal right to breach the contract. Not reading the contract is not a defense. But I still think I'm getting scammed. Consumer law?

Their ranking with the BBB (Better Business Bureau) is an "F" exactly for this reason. The ironic thing is that the BBB actually works for the business that pays the BBB to rank them..so they are paying to tell everyone they are a horrible company.

I am writing the cancellation letter, and will wait and see what happens.
